Multiple defendants are often involved in mesothelioma lawsuits. Victims can file a lawsuit for asbestos exposure against a variety of companies. These lawsuits also seek compensation for medical expenses, lost wages and other financial losses due to mesothelioma.

Asbestos sufferers should also think about filing a workers' compensation claim if their exposure to asbestos happened on the job. Mesothelioma lawyers can assist their clients in the procedure of submitting workers' compensation claims and other documents necessary to complete a successful case.

Wrongful death claims are a different type of mesothelioma suit that could result in significant financial damages for the loved ones of the victim. These lawsuits are filed by the spouses of survivors or children of asbestos victims who have died.

Numerous asbestos producers and companies that dealt with this material have established trust funds for their victims. A mesothelioma lawyer who is skilled will know how to access these trust funds and ensure you get the benefits you deserve. They will also be familiar with VA benefits for veterans who were exposed to asbestos while serving in the military. These benefits include health insurance, disability pay pensions, monthly compensation and monthly pay.

The most reputable mesothelioma lawyers will not charge any upfront fees or make you pay for their services unless they succeed in your case. This arrangement, referred to as a contingent fee allows victims to receive the best representation. A contingency is a percentage from the final compensation that you or your loved ones receive. This means that you aren't responsible for any out-of pocket fees.
